摘要
Amorphous carbon (a-C) films were deposited by pulsed unbalanced magnetron sputtering method, the effects of substrate temperature on the structure, optical and electrical properties of the a-C films were investigated. It has been found that the sp(3) fraction in the a-C films increases with increasing substrate temperature from 50 to 100 degrees C, while decreases with increasing substrate temperature from 100 to 200 degrees C. Optical and electrical measurements show that the refractive index, optical band gap and electrical resistivity are strongly dependent on the substrate temperature. The a-C films deposited at 100 degrees C have higher refractive index, optical band gap and electrical resistivity. The possible reason for all the above observation was discussed.
